Dear Tanaya,  your clothes should be simple and light. No strip patters as they can be speculated to be able to hide communicative devices under datk colours. And pockets means you will be thoroughly checkes and you might feel inconvenient. So it is always best to keep it plain with no extrinsic designs, big buttons and embroidery. No ornamebts or jewellery of whatsover metal like chains, rings, anklets, nosepins, bangles, bracelets are allowed. Please team up your trouser with half sleeved kurti/kurta/top again which is simple, plain and light.
